It's been a couple weeks ago, but I guess I need to post up my buddies Wyoming general tag bull.
Here's my friend Mike with his bull:
It was getting late so we didn't take as much time on pictures as we should have and didn't get any pictures of us together, but here's a picture of me with his bull.
He was very big bodied and lot's of fun to pack out, but that's what elk hunting is all about right?
We had a great time and I was very happy to be there with my friend Mike when he shot his biggest bull of his life. Going through it all again in my head, I'm really happy that I was slower on the trigger pull than him and he was able to end up with a really nice bull on the ground.
Had the whole family up there with me this year. This is my favorite camp picture from the trip. Doesn't get much better than cowboy hats and toy guns for two 4 and 5 year old boys!
